Set up linear program and explain Suppose you are helping lo create a student schedule for a peer tutoring lab. The need for service fluctuates during work hours (8 a.m. to 5 p.m). The minimum number of students needed is 2 between 8 a.m - 10 a.m., 3 between 10 a.m. and 11 a.m., 4 between 11 a.m and 1 p.m and 3 between 1 p.m. and 5 p.m. Each student is allotted 3 consecutive hours (except for those starting at 3 p.m. who work for 2 hours, and those who start at 4 p.m. who work for one hour) Because of their flexible schedules, the student workers can usually report to work at any hour during the work day, except that no student worker wants lo start working at lunch time (noon). Determine the minimum number of students the department should employ and specify the time of the day at which they should each report to work. Complete this problem as follows: Set up a linear programming model for this scenario so that the number of students is minimized. Make sure you define your variables well, and create your model in a clear and complete manner. Solve your model on Undo. Interpret your results: Give a complete and practical interpretation of your results ( state it in a way that your non-technical colleagues will understand) Put all results into a single file as stated in the directions at the top of the page.
